Prévia do material em texto
A segurança e a criptografia no back-end são elementos cruciais na proteção de dados em aplicações web. Este ensaio explora a importância desses aspectos, o impacto das tecnologias de segurança e criptografia, e os desenvolvimentos recentes na área. Serão discutidos os desafios enfrentados e as inovações que moldam o futuro da segurança da informação. Nos últimos anos, as ameaças cibernéticas aumentaram significativamente. O número de ataques como phishing, ransomware e vazamentos de dados se tornou alarmante. Isso gerou uma necessidade urgente de sistemas de segurança robustos que assegurem a confidencialidade, integridade e disponibilidade das informações. No back-end, a segurança é fundamental para proteger dados sensíveis, como informações pessoais e financeiras dos usuários. A criptografia é a técnica usada para codificar informações, de modo que apenas partes autorizadas possam acessá-las. Ela é um componente importante das estratégias de segurança e é amplamente utilizada em comunicações e armazenamentos de dados. As técnicas de criptografia evoluíram ao longo do tempo, desde os métodos clássicos até os algoritmos modernos, como AES e RSA. A criptografia simétrica e assimétrica desempenham papéis distintos, sendo a primeira mais rápida e a segunda proporcionando maneiras de trocar chaves de maneira segura. Influentes no desenvolvimento de criptografia moderna, como Whitfield Diffie e Martin Hellman, introduziram a troca de chaves públicas. Esse conceito revolucionou a forma como os dados são protegidos na internet. Além disso, a contribuição de figuras como Bruce Schneier destacou a importância de entender a segurança não apenas em termos de tecnologia, mas também em aspectos humanos e processuais. Uma das principais questões que surgem na discussão de segurança e criptografia é a proteção contra ataques de força bruta. Esses ataques tentam decifrar informações por meio da repetição incessante de combinações possíveis. Para mitigar esse risco, práticas de segurança como a implementação de limites de tentativas de login e o uso de autenticação multifator tornaram-se fundamentais nas arquiteturas de back-end. Outro desafio significativo é a questão da privacidade dos dados. Com a implementação de regulações como a Lei Geral de Proteção de Dados no Brasil, as empresas precisam garantir que seus sistemas de criptografia estejam alinhados às normas de proteção de informações pessoais. Isso não apenas protege o usuário, mas também promove a confiança na plataforma. Recentemente, a ascensão da tecnologia de blockchain trouxe novos paradigmas para a segurança da informação. Com sua natureza descentralizada, o blockchain oferece uma abordagem única para o armazenamento e transferência de dados. Essa tecnologia foi inicialmente implementada no Bitcoin, mas hoje suas aplicações se estendem a contratos inteligentes e registros de propriedade digital, trazendo segurança adicional contra manipulações e fraudes. Ainda assim, a segurança no back-end não se resume apenas a criptografia. É fundamental implementar uma arquitetura de segurança em camadas. Isso inclui firewalls, sistemas de detecção de intrusões, e políticas de acesso restrito. O treinamento e a conscientização dos funcionários também são vitais para evitar que vulnerabilidades humanas comprometam sistemas perfeitamente seguros. Na perspectiva futura, devemos considerar o impacto da computação quântica na criptografia. Com os avanços nessa área, muitos algoritmos de criptografia atualmente em uso podem se tornar obsoletos. A pesquisa em criptografia pós-quântica se torna uma prioridade para garantir que os dados permaneçam seguros em um futuro onde os computadores quânticos possam quebrar a segurança tradicional. Além disso, o aumento do uso de inteligência artificial (IA) na segurança cibernética apresenta tanto oportunidades quanto desafios. A IA pode ajudar a identificar e responder a ameaças em tempo real, mas também pode ser utilizada por cibercriminosos para desenvolver ataques mais sofisticados. Assim, a interação entre IA e criptografia precisa ser cuidadosamente estudada. Em conclusão, a segurança e a criptografia no back-end são essenciais para a proteção de dados e a confiança em sistemas digitais. Conforme as tecnologias evoluem, é imperativo que os profissionais de segurança se mantenham atualizados sobre as melhores práticas, novas ameaças e inovações emergentes. A implementação de soluções robustas, combinando criptografia com uma arquitetura de segurança abrangente, é fundamental para enfrentar os desafios da era digital. Questões de alternativa: 1. Qual é a principal função da criptografia no contexto de segurança da informação? a) Aumentar a velocidade do processamento de dados b) Proteger a confidencialidade das informações c) Reduzir o custo das aplicações d) Facilitar a troca de dados não confidenciais 2. O que é considerado um ataque de força bruta? a) Um tipo de ataque que utiliza inteligência artificial para enganar os sistemas b) Um ataque que tenta decifrar informações através de tentativas exaustivas de combinações c) Um método de proteger dados por meio de firewalls d) Um tipo de ataque que não busca acesso a informações pessoais 3. Como a computação quântica pode impactar a segurança da criptografia? a) Tornando os algoritmos de criptografia mais robustos b) Facilitando a implementação de sistemas de segurança c) Possivelmente quebrando algoritmos de criptografia existentes d) Eliminando a necessidade de criptografia em todos os sistemas Respostas corretas: 1-b, 2-b, 3-c.